What is Roblox?

Roblox seeks to bring people from around the globe together through the sheer enjoyment of gaming. Users have the opportunity to express their creativity, build, and socialize with friends while exploring a multitude of captivating 3D worlds, all developed by a varied group of creators. Each month, more than two million developers contribute to this vibrant platform by designing distinctive multiplayer adventures using Roblox Studio, a user-friendly desktop design tool. The scope for creation on Roblox seems limitless, catering to an audience primarily under 18 and consistently ranking as a top online entertainment destination, as evidenced by impressive average monthly visits and engagement metrics. The platform flourishes on the active participation of its community, with new users frequently joining through recommendations from existing players.     Great fun creating games in Roblox Studio, but with some issues and useless support

    Date: Jan 09 2023
    Summary

    All in all, Roblox is absolutely fantastic and opens a whole world of fun. It warms my heart to see players out there actually enjoy the games I create :)
    It's great that they release frequent new features, but I think they need to focus more on fixing existing bugs, and to provide devs with a working support instead of that crappy AI.

    Positive

    Roblox Studio is feature-rich, yet easy to get started with. There are tons of assets, created by either Roblox or other users, to use in your games. Creating your own games in Roblox Studio is extremely fun and addictive.

    As Roblox is a social platform with millions of users, it is well suited for multiplayer experiences and it is easy to publish your games for others to play.

    Documentation is alright and if you get puzzled sometimes, you can almost always find someone who has had the same problem at the DevForum.

    The rate at which new features are released is amazing! Roblox boasts some pretty advanced and nifty technology such as support for VR and motion capturing from videos.

    Negative

    Support is driven by so called AI, which should rather be called artificial *un*intelligence as it fails to understand your issues like a 100% of the time and keeps repeating the same automated answers over and over again, which is not of any help at all.

    Roblox do not seem to care much about bugs. Some bugs that would be easy to fix, remain unresolved for months and even years.

    Lua is a bit of an odd language in my opinion. If I had got to choose I would have gone with some more "normal" language like C# or Javascript. Also, the script editor integrated in Roblox Studio lacks some great features found in VS Code, such as multicaret editing to mention one.

    As Roblox is mostly targeted to kids, there are some restrictions limiting your creative freedom. Games like Leisure Suite Larry or GTA would have been banned on Roblox.

    There are some issues with the GUI, like that the stacking of panels is reset when restarting Studio.

    Roblox servers are often down, which seems to have gotten worse during the past year. The most annoying thing is that when Roblox is down, so is Roblox Studio and you can't develop anything during the downtime.

    Good games

    Updated: May 19 2022
    Summary

    Overall, Roblox has great games (or should I say: experiences) for free. Roblox supports a wide variety of operating systems.

    Positive

    You can make your experiences on Roblox for free using the Lua language.
    There are a lot of experiences on Roblox that you can play, some free and some paid using Robux or Premium.

    Negative

    If you have an account under 13 (if the birthday of the account is under 13 years), you can not say numbers, which is annoying.
